Phlebia Incarnata
''Phlebia incarnata'' is a species of polypore fungus in the family Meruliaceae. It is inedible. Taxonomy The species was originally described as ''Merulius incarnatus'' by Lewis David de Schweinitz in 1822. In its taxonomic history, it has been transferred to the genera ''Cantharellus'' (1832), ''Sesia'' (1891), and ''Byssomerulius'' (1974), and renamed as a form of '' Merulius tremellosus''. A fungus ( : fungi or funguses) is any member of the group of eukaryotic organisms that includes microorganisms such as yeasts and molds, as well as the more familiar mushrooms. These organisms are classified as a kingdom, separately from the other eukaryotic kingdoms, which by one traditional classification include Plantae, Animalia, Protozoa, and Chromista. A characteristic that places fungi in a different kingdom from plants, bacteria, and some protists is chitin in their cell walls. Fungi, like animals, are heterotrophs; they acquire their food by absorbing dissolved molecules, typically by secreting digestive enzymes into their environment. Fungi do not photosynthesize. Growth is their means of mobility, except for spores (a few of which are flagellated), which may travel through the air or water. Fungi are the principal decomposers in ecological systems. Lewis David De Schweinitz
Lewis David de Schweinitz (13 February 1780 – 8 February 1834) was a German-American botanist and mycologist. He is considered by some the "Father of North American Mycology", but also made significant contributions to botany. Education Born in Bethlehem, Pennsylvania, a great-grandson of Count Nikolaus Ludwig von Zinzendorf und Pottendorf, founder and patron of the Moravian Church, in 1787 Schweinitz was placed in the institution of the Moravian community at Nazareth, Pennsylvania, where he remained for 11 years and was a successful and industrious student. Schweinitz later entered the Theological seminary at Niesky (Saxony) in 1798. In 1805, he published the ''Conspectus Fungorum in Lusatiae'' in collaboration with his teacher, Professor J.B. Albertini. Early career In 1807 he went to Gnadenberg (in Silesia), then subsequently to Gnadau to work as a preacher in the Moravian church. MycoBank
MycoBank is an online database, documenting new mycological names and combinations, eventually combined with descriptions and illustrations. It is run by the Westerdijk Fungal Biodiversity Institute in Utrecht. Each novelty, after being screened by nomenclatural experts and found in accordance with the ICN ( International Code of Nomenclature for algae, fungi, and plants), is allocated a unique MycoBank number before the new name has been validly published. This number then can be cited by the naming author in the publication where the new name is being introduced. Only then, this unique number becomes public in the database. By doing so, this system can help solve the problem of knowing which names have been validly published and in which year. MycoBank is linked to other important mycological databases such as ''Index Fungorum'', Life Science Identifiers, Global Biodiversity Information Facility (GBIF) and other databases. Merulius Tremellosus
''Phlebia tremellosa'' (formerly ''Merulius tremellosus''), commonly known as trembling Merulius or jelly rot, is a species of fungus in the family Meruliaceae. It is a common and widely distributed wood-decay fungus that grows on the rotting wood of both hardwood and conifer plants. Taxonomy The fungus was originally described in 1794 by German botanist Heinrich Adolf Schrader, who called it ''Merulius tremellosus''. Nakasone and Burdsall transferred the taxon to the genus ''Phlebia'' in 1984, when they placed ''Merulius'' in synonymy. It is commonly known as the "trembling Merulius", or "jelly rot". Description Fruit bodies of the fungus are fan-shaped to semicircular, measuring wide by long. They have a spongy to fibrous texture, comprising stalkless caps or spreading crusts. The upper surface, white to pale yellow in colour, can be dry to moist, and hairy to woolly; the margin is usually white to translucent. Form (botany)
In botanical nomenclature, a ''form'' (''forma'', plural ''formae'') is one of the "secondary" taxonomic ranks, below that of variety, which in turn is below that of species; it is an infraspecific taxon. If more than three ranks are listed in describing a taxon, the "classification" is being specified, but only three parts make up the "name" of the taxon: a genus name, a specific epithet, and an infraspecific epithet. The abbreviation "f." or the full "forma" should be put before the infraspecific epithet to indicate the rank. It is not italicised. For example: * '' Acanthocalycium spiniflorum'' f. ''klimpelianum'' or ** ''Acanthocalycium spiniflorum'' forma ''klimpelianum'' (Weidlich & Werderm.) Donald * ''Crataegus aestivalis'' (Walter) Torr. & A.Gray var. ''cerasoides'' Sarg. f. ''luculenta'' Sarg. is a classification of a plant whose name is: ** ''Crataegus aestivalis'' (Walter) Torr. & A.Gray f. ''luculenta'' Sarg. Cantharellus
''Cantharellus'' is a genus of popular edible mushrooms, commonly known as chanterelles, a name which can also refer to the type species, ''Cantharellus cibarius''. They are mycorrhizal fungi, meaning they form symbiotic associations with plants, making them very difficult to cultivate. Caution must be used when identifying chanterelles for consumption due to lookalikes, such as the jack-o'-lantern mushroom (''Omphalotus olearius'' and others), which can make a person very ill. Despite this, chanterelles are one of the most recognized and harvested groups of edible mushrooms. Many species of chanterelles contain antioxidant carotenoids, such as beta-carotene in ''C. cibarius'' and ''C. minor'', and canthaxanthin in ''C. cinnabarinus'' and ''C. friesii''. They also contain significant amounts of vitamin D. The name comes from Greek κάνθαρος, ''kantharos'' 'tankard, cup'.

Taxonomy (biology)
In biology, taxonomy () is the scientific study of naming, defining ( circumscribing) and classifying groups of biological organisms based on shared characteristics. Organisms are grouped into taxa (singular: taxon) and these groups are given a taxonomic rank; groups of a given rank can be aggregated to form a more inclusive group of higher rank, thus creating a taxonomic hierarchy. The principal ranks in modern use are domain, kingdom, phylum (''division'' is sometimes used in botany in place of ''phylum''), class, order, family, genus, and species. The Swedish botanist Carl Linnaeus is regarded as the founder of the current system of taxonomy, as he developed a ranked system known as Linnaean taxonomy for categorizing organisms and binomial nomenclature for naming organisms. Basidiomycota
Basidiomycota () is one of two large divisions that, together with the Ascomycota, constitute the subkingdom Dikarya (often referred to as the "higher fungi") within the kingdom Fungi. Members are known as basidiomycetes. More specifically, Basidiomycota includes these groups: mushrooms, puffballs, stinkhorns, bracket fungi, other polypores, jelly fungi, boletes, chanterelles, earth stars, smuts, bunts, rusts, mirror yeasts, and ''Cryptococcus'', the human pathogenic yeast. Basidiomycota are filamentous fungi composed of hyphae (except for basidiomycota-yeast) and reproduce sexually via the formation of specialized club-shaped end cells called basidia that normally bear external meiospores (usually four). These specialized spores are called basidiospores. However, some Basidiomycota are obligate asexual reproducers.
